Adjusting Volume Levels

  • πŸ“ž Adjust call volume by opening the phone app and using the volume up button during an active call.
  • πŸ”Š For media volume, you can use the volume up button directly or navigate to Settings β†’ Sound & vibration to use a slider for finer control.

System Settings and Speaker Maintenance

  • πŸ”• Ensure Do Not Disturb mode is disabled by checking that the switch in Settings β†’ Sound & vibration is gray, indicating it's off.
  • 🧼 Clean the speaker grills, especially near the charging port, to remove any dirt or blockages that could impede sound output.

Software and System Updates

  • πŸ”„ Restart your phone by holding the power and volume up buttons, then selecting reboot, to refresh the system and potentially resolve temporary glitches.
  • πŸš€ Check for and install HyperOS software updates via Settings β†’ About phone β†’ HyperOS, as updates often contain fixes for audio glitches.
